VB.NET, ouvrir des dossiers dans l'explorateur windows?
J'ai un problème avec l'ouverture de dossier spécifique dans VB.net dans l'Explorateur Windows. J'ai utilisé
Process.Start("explorer.exe", "Folder_Path")
Toujours quand j'ai essayé cette il d'ouvrir des documents dans l'explorateur , ce que j'ai écrit. Svp aider.
- Cochez cette<stackoverflow.com/questions/3887364/...>
Vous devez vous connecter pour publier un commentaire.
Essayez de l'ouvrir avec:
Ou modifier le chemin d'accès avant:
Et si elle échoue encore, rendez-vous avec la commande shell:
La raison pour laquelle il ouvre le répertoire par défaut (Documents) pourrait être l'une de ces deux raisons:
· Le répertoire n'existe pas.
· Le chemin d'accès au répertoire contient des espaces dans le nom, et les arguments contenant des espaces doivent être joints à doublequotes, c'est une règle de BASE de la programmation.
Donc utiliser la syntaxe suivante properrlly:
Vous puissiez commencer à explorer avec présélectionnés répertoire comme ceci:
L'Explorateur Windows options sont expliquées dans ce Article de base de connaissances Microsoft.
L' .txt pourrait être ce que jamais u besoin.
C:\File_Name.txt
existe. Autrement explorer.exe s'ouvre sur le répertoire racine, en particulier, si le nom de fichier seraitC:\temp\subdir\File_Name.txt
. Il ne s'ouvre pas dansC:\temp\subdir
.Vous pouvez essayer de Processus.Début("explorer.exe", "Folder_Path") comme vous l'avez dit.
La seule raison que l'explorateur windows ouvre le dossier documents, c'est que vous faites une faute de frappe, le "folder_path" et le dossier spécifié doen n'existe pas